Transaction 63237617ec4e30a33fec3a9c44ecf2141c20744b7f8c66d8724db26bde2cc427
1 Input
1 Output
-
63237617ec4e30a33fec3a9c44ecf2141c20744b7f8c66d8724db26bde2cc427:0
- value
- 243689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efaeb0b96dd941156a03d9855c1625df160bbccf OP_EQUAL
- address
- 3PYLh64d8nNcb8CTg3ZzvikHCXEdRtod8Z